Lilian stepped out of her cultivation room, cradling Sunny gently in her arms. The little fox’s wide eyes sparkled with curiosity as he immediately scampered off, eager to investigate the strange new environment around him. The soft hum of the building and the faint scent of blooming flowers outside created a calm atmosphere, but Sunny’s energetic exploration brought a lively contrast to the quiet space.

Pulling out her phone, Lilian noticed several missed calls blinking on the screen. Among them were calls from Mr. Arron, Karina, and a few numbers she didn’t recognize. Just as she was about to return the calls later, Mr. Arron’s name popped up again, demanding her immediate attention.

She swiped to answer.

“Kid, did you really manage to cure that little girl from the Shanks family?” Mr. Arron’s voice came through, a mixture of surprise and amusement coloring his tone.

“I did,” Lilian replied evenly, her voice steady despite the weight of the news.

“No wonder the old man was so overjoyed when he called me,” Mr. Arron chuckled softly. “He said his granddaughter’s completely healed, and even his daughter-in-law is showing signs of improvement. They’re so thrilled, they’re planning a banquet to celebrate and invite all their friends to share the good news.”

He laughed again, a warm sound that carried a hint of irony. “And here I was wondering why Houston kept poking around, asking about your abilities. Turns out, he was fishing for information to help his own child.”

Lilian smiled quietly, a soft chuckle escaping her lips. “Yes, Mr. Houston did mention he reached out to you. I didn’t think much of it at the time.”

“Well, I’m glad it worked out,” Mr. Arron said with a satisfied sigh. “That illness has haunted their family for more than ten years. Now the old man can finally breathe easy.”

Just as they were about to end the call, Lilian’s phone rang again. This time, it was Karina.

“Lilian, where have you been? I’ve been trying to get in touch with you forever,” Karina said, relief evident in her voice.

“I’m fine,” Lilian replied, moving toward the bar and pouring herself a glass of water. The cool liquid slid down her throat, easing the tension in her chest. “What’s going on? Is it urgent?”

“Well, yes and no,” Karina answered. “Remember when you asked me to keep an eye out for promising research institutions? Most of them are already well-established, and honestly, it’s tough to get in without powerful connections.”
